    Misty Double Glazing Repair

    Window-Repairs.-150x150.jpgA misty glass double-glazed window is a sign of damaged seals. This allows moisture to get into the window, and then condense on the cold glass, reducing efficiency.

    This issue is easily avoided by using extractor fans in damp areas such as kitchens and bathrooms, and opening windows to allow airflow. Dehumidifiers are also useful in reducing moisture.

    Seals

    Usually, when double glazing becomes blurred, there is something wrong with the window seals. It could be due to the glass unit or the windows could be older and more prone to issues. In any situation, it is crucial to have the windows checked for any issues as soon as possible to prevent further damage to the insulation properties of the double glazing.

    The space between the two glass panes is filled up with Argon or another inert gas to boost efficiency in energy use. This setup creates an insulating barrier that keeps warm air inside and cold air out, and is one of the main reasons why double glazed windows are more efficient than traditional single-glazing. However, with time, this seal may be damaged and, when it is, moisture will begin to leak in and cause a cloudy appearance.

    In certain cases, this can be fixed using a defogging kit that can be purchased online or at hardware stores. The procedure involves drilling a small opening into the window, then injecting a desiccant that absorbs moisture, and sealing the hole. However defogging kits can be just a temporary solution and should be done repeatedly as the inert gases don't replace the original ones lost when the seal broke down.

    Condensation in double-glazed windows is usually caused by a large contrast between the indoor and outdoor temperatures. This issue also occurs in the UK. It is possible to fix this by reducing the temperature variations and enhancing ventilation.

    If the window is brand new, this may not be a viable alternative. Double-glazed windows typically last between 15 and 20 years. This is due to various factors, such as age, environmental pressures and debris from outside, as well as harsh cleaning agents.

    When the seals on double-glazed window fail, water vapour could enter the insulation section. This can cause condensation and fogging. If this happens, the insulation qualities of your windows will be drastically diminished. In some instances the moisture may cause wood frames to crack and rot.

    To address the issue, you can use a desiccant like silica beads. This requires drilling a tiny hole into the glass pane and putting in a desiccant to absorb the excess water. This is a simple, cheap fix but it will not solve the problem for long.

    The most efficient option is to replace the double-glazed unit completely. This is the fastest and most efficient way to resolve the issue.     Moisture

    The power of double glazing lies in the fact that it consists of two glass panes that are separated by a thermally efficient spacer bar, which is filled with air or Argon gas. This creates a barrier that keeps heat in and keeps out cold air. However, this system can be compromised by the buildup of moisture between the glass panes. This can lead to numerous issues including unsightly foggy patches to increased energy bills.     Heat loss

    Typically, if you see mist on your double-glazed it's an indication that there is moisture between the glass panes. The moisture is usually water vapour that is caused by a difference in air temperature on both sides of the glass. In the majority of cases, you'll just need to wipe the inside of your window with a cloth regularly. If condensation is beginning to build up between the panes or on the exterior of your window, you should seek out professional assistance.

    If the condensation is located between window panes, this could be an indication that sealants have been damaged or worn out. This can be caused by poor weather conditions or damage resulting from cleaning products.
